Recently, a similar thread in the THub was closed:

Explanation: “We are closing this topic as “Won’t Fix” for technical reasons: car headlights are aligned to game-world timing and cannot react to brightness”.

Okay, they cannot react to environmental brightness (which makes sense) but they surely could react to a keybind, i.e. be activated manually? :slight_smile:

The same goes for wipers.

These features are a must-have for a title that’s meant to be considered a sim :wink:

I just want to have control under lights in the race, because the game turns them on really late sometimes and it’s annoying. It would be great to have them on d-pad instead of kinda useless chat, cause if I want to tell something to anyone I will tell him it after the race.
And it would be a nice feature to have a high and low beams, cause in multiclass racing it can help to remind slow class cars that there’s faster class approaching.
Also turning lights can help to tell slower class drivers where will you go to let faster class go through.
And hazard lights can replace chat if you need to tell someone “Thank you”:slight_smile:
